Transaction 251367f6b3b0cf3acfcd6c36fe975979321fd0616d94f35a29e5274bb3f1c28e
1 Input
1 Output
-
251367f6b3b0cf3acfcd6c36fe975979321fd0616d94f35a29e5274bb3f1c28e:0
- value
- 64762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 36a18c721772679a6805f2d8395df4164eb27354 OP_EQUAL
- address
- 36fswVnsCjkmb6CbCVDjoJivVvhDj7X2z9